The Hero Ingredient

Bananas take top points as the most wasted fruit in the world. We wanted to be part of taking them down a peg or two, so we teamed up with The Carnarvon Sweeter Banana Co-Op, a collective of 18 family-run farms on the banks of the Gascoyne River here in WA. Though it was the first place bananas were ever grown in Australia, it’s not exactly an easy climate to deal with. The harsh conditions means Carnarvon bananas take much longer to grow, winding up sweeter and creamier than other bananas (win!) but also occasionally also a little bruised and battered (lose). These ones aren’t wanted by supermarket shelves, and are often wasted, left to go back in to the paddock as fertiliser. We think all lovingly grown spray-free bananas deserve to be used, so we go out and collect the ‘ugly’ ones each week, and put them to good use making a new and improved kind of vodka.

How we made it

You know how when you make banana bread it tastes way better when the bananas are super brown? Turns out, it’s the same with spirits. After we let them get nice and overripe, we puree the bananas with hot water, then add enzymes that are traditional in wine and whisky making. The enzymes get to work eating up all the starches and proteins, separating the puree into sweeter juice and pulp. We then do a quick strain to remove the biggest bits of pulp, before adding yeast to the sweet juice to ferment it, just like a wine or a beer. After 1 week of fermenting, we have a ‘banana wine’ at approximately 10% alcohol. We distil this wine at least twice to increase the alcohol content and strip a lot of the flavours. Finally, we blend with our neutral grape spirit, distill again, charcoal filter it, reduce to bottling strength with reverse osmosis water and leave to rest for a couple of weeks. After all that - voila! It’s good as gold.

The rest of the goods…

  • Neutral Grape-Based Spirit

    Our neutral spirit is premium stuff - it’s sourced from the Barossa Valley, and is made from the grape skin pulp left over in the winemaking process. This pulp is called pomace, or marc, and has a long history of being used to create a spirit, often used to fortify wines like port or sherry, or drunk on its own (ever heard of Italian grappa?). The grapes have been selected from the best parcels of land in the Barossa, before being distilled up to a very high purity (96%), neutralising flavour to become the base of our tasty spirits.

East 8 Hold Up

  • 45ml Gone Bananas Vodka
  • 15ml Smashed Apple Aperitivo
  • 20ml Pineapple Juice
  • 15ml Lime Juice
  • 10ml Sugar Syrup (1 part sugar : 1 part water)
  • 5ml Passionfruit Syrup

Add all ingredients to a cocktail shaker with cubed ice, shake hard for 20 seconds, strain into a tumbler over fresh ice and garnish with a mint sprig and passionfruit.
